No Matter which areas of the industry you choose to work in upon
the completion of your course, you will need to have a pleasant
personality, be confident in dealing with people, and possess
dedication, flexibility, flair and creativity. You will also need to be a
lateral and progressive thinker and show an acceptance of various
cultural and ethnic groups within the hospitality industry and the
society at large. You will need to shoulder social responsibility towards
individuals, social groups in general and to the needs of the others
within the industry.You should have the ability to undertake a diverse
range of tasks in an appreciative and technically competent manner.
Willingness to Serve
This is one of the basic requirements and also the most important. Are you
type who would go out of your way to make people happy? Even though
they may be total strangers?
The doctrine of IHM is “Enter to Learn, Go Forth to Serve, and Serve
with Pleasure, one and all”.
Regardless of what branch of the hospitality field you choose, you have
got to SERVE and that too WITH A SMILE. You may dislike the person or
the fact that you have to serve him/her. But you have got to go through
with it. Most importantly after you have given your best, don’t expect
appreciation from the guest.
If it comes your way, it is a bonus.
